GOLDEN GLOBE-NOMINATED ACTRESS EVA LONGORIA TO GUEST-STAR ON "EMPIRE" THIS SPRING ON FOX

EMPIRE Returns Wednesday, March 22, on FOX

Golden Globe nominee Eva Longoria ("Desperate Housewives," "Devious Maids") will guest-star on broadcast's No. 1 drama, EMPIRE, this spring on FOX. Longoria will play "Charlotte Frost," the formidable director of the all-powerful state gaming commission. Charlotte has the power to make-or-break Lucious' (Terrence Howard) dreams of expanding Empire's reach to Las Vegas and beneath her alluring facade, lies a force of darkness and corruption.

The battle between Lucious and Cookie explodes into their biggest war yet, when EMPIRE returns Wednesday, March 22 (9:00-10:00 PM ET/PT) on FOX. After launching a deadly missile at Angelo, Lucious announces his new music project, Inferno, and puts everyone on notice - especially Cookie, who then vows to knock him off his throne for good. The two engage in an epic clash - fueled by a history of love, loyalty and betrayal.

Longoria joins previously announced actors and musicians who appear on EMPIRE this spring, including Taye Diggs, Phylicia Rashad, Rumer Willis and Nia Long.

Eva Longoria is a Golden Globe-nominated, Screen Actors Guild- and ALMA Award-winning actress, producer, director, entrepreneur, philanthropist and "Desperate Housewives" alumnus. She stars opposite Academy Award nominee Demian Bichir in the upcoming feature film "Low Riders," slated for release on May 12. She also is featured in the British miniseries "Decline and Fall," opposite U.K. comedy star Jack Whitehall, which premieres this spring. Additionally, she directed an episode of the Golden Globe-nominated series "Jane the Virgin," and is set to direct the Emmy Award-winning series "Black-ish." Longoria recently celebrated 10 years as a Global Brand Ambassador for L'Oreal Paris. She owns BESO Restaurant in Hollywood, the production company UnbeliEVAble Entertainment and fragrances "EVA" and "EVAmour." She also has a New York Times best-selling cookbook, "Eva's Kitchen," and a home collection line with JC Penney. Her greatest work is as a champion of women, the Latino community and youth with special needs. She is founder of The Eva Longoria Foundation, to help Latinas build better futures for themselves and their families through education and entrepreneurship; co-founder of Eva's Heroes, which enriches the lives of those with intellectual special needs by providing an inclusive setting built on the four tenets of interact, grow, learn and love; and is the National Spokesperson for "Padres Contra el Cancer," a non-profit organization that is committed to improving the quality of life for Latino children with cancer and their families.

From Imagine Television in association with 20th Century Fox Television, EMPIRE was created by Academy Award nominee Lee Daniels and Emmy Award winner Danny Strong, and is executive-produced by Daniels, Strong, Academy Award- and Emmy Award-winning producer Brian Grazer, Ilene Chaiken, Francie Calfo and Sanaa Hamri.
